Editorial Reviews Joseph Haydn (1732-1809) Feldparthien Linos Ensemble After their first CD with cahmber music for wind instruments by Joseph Haydn (Capriccio 10719), the Linos Ensemble has now turned to Haydn's so-called "Feldparthien" (Divertimentos for Wind): Music for wind instruments and double bass to be played in the open air, among them the: "Chorale St. Antoni" that inspired Johannes Brahms to write his "Variations on a Theme by Joseph Haydn". The Linos Ensemble, lately distinguished with excellent reviews for the CD series with works by composers from the Schoenberg circle (Capriccio 10863, 10864, 10865), once more proves that it is the leading ensemble of its kind in Germany.
